[Photo] Era of 3% Base Interest Rate, 5% Regular Savings Accounts Appear
As the benchmark interest rate reached 3% for the first time in 10 years, commercial banks have successively raised deposit rates, bringing bank fixed deposit interest rates close to 5% per annum. On the 26th, a banner displaying fixed savings interest rates was posted at a commercial bank in Seoul./Reporter Kang Jin-hyung aymsdream@
